Loorberg Climb

Highlight (Segment) • Climb

Nice steady climb of about 1 km. The percentage of average 6% is also fine for the less well trained cyclist, it never gets really super strong. Nice climb to get into the rhythm.

Vaalserberg Three-Country Point

Highlight • Monument

With a height of no less than 322.4 meters above NAP, the Vaalserberg is the highest mountain in the Netherlands (with the exception of the mountains in the Caribbean). So …
